We compared two Desktop platform GPUs: 32GB VRAM FirePro S9170 and 1024MB VRAM Radeon HD 6850 1440SP Edition to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D FirePro S9170 's Advantages
Released 2 years and 11 months late
More VRAM (32GB vs 1GB)
Larger VRAM bandwidth (320.0GB/s vs 128.0GB/s)
1376 additional rendering cores
AMD Radeon HD 6850 1440SP Edition 's Advantages
Lower TDP (151W vs 275W)
